Patriotic Events in Twin Lakes Area

There is no better way to celebrate and commemorate our amazing country than sharing it with fun, friends, and fireworks in Mountain Home, Arkansas. Each year thousands of people line their boats in the blue waters of Lake Norfork to watch Independence Eve in Henderson, Arkansas. This year celebrates 30 years of Independence Eve festivities and this picture depicts the volume of boaters enjoying the beauty of patriotic celebration.

July 4th’s UNOFFICIAL Parade on Denton Ferry Road near Cotter, Arkansas was organized several years ago at the home of Tommy & Shella Hagan. The parade has grown from 3 decorated lawn mowers to various types of vehicles including an airplane! Friends and neighbors gather with parade entries and lawn chairs for the celebration and to give thanks to those who fought to keep our country free.

The 16th annual Red, White, & Blue Festival is a community festival set in the Ozark Mountains in Mountain Home, Arkansas. The festival offers a parade, rodeo, car show, concerts, kids’ activities, food, and more. The highlight of the festival was an amazing fireworks display on the Arkansas State University campus.
